Output ccc0807f99537860f1063d04afb981c4838e6cd8a5c8bfd8fb476e2c28b51007:6

value
89633
script pubkey
OP_0 OP_PUSHBYTES_20 f83ef84732a5922c42317ce97e14a42eea7e6c8a
address
bc1qlql0s3ej5kfzcs330n5hu99y9m48umy2xqpx0w
transaction
ccc0807f99537860f1063d04afb981c4838e6cd8a5c8bfd8fb476e2c28b51007
confirmations
17912
spent
true